Abstract

A tamper indicating seal for doors or panels such as used on airborne shipping containers. The seal includes a housing mounted over an edge of a container door and having an opening for receiving a strap of an elongated shackle having a base portion engageable with a frame or other portion of the container. A locking cage is disposed within the opening and interlocks with the strap as the strap is pulled outwardly of the opening to thereby secure the housing to the container such that any attempt to open the door will cause a visual failure of the housing.
